1

I need to set Android status bar semi-translucent with a color like tint effect on iOS 7, i've reviewed the documentation, but it only explains how to get a gradient translucent status bar.

I've seen the effect on Samsung Galaxy S5 stock dialer app, so I want to perform this effect. This is the effect:

enter image description here

For example this is an example app that show an effect similar that I want to make, but instead a gradient to transparent I want the whole status bar with solid color behind the solid semi translucent status bar:

https://play.google.com/store/apps/details?id=com.readystatesoftware.systembartint.sample&hl=es

Any help would be great. Thanks in advance.

2
  • Maybe adding a picture of the Samsung Galaxy S5 stock dialer app would be nice?
    – Idris
    Jun 23, 2014 at 2:46
  • I think this picture is SG S5 stock dialer's. Jun 23, 2014 at 3:03

2 Answers 2

1

Have you tried to set color over the pattern #OORRGGBB?

Example: #50ff0000. The first two numbers are the opacity.

Anyway, I've found this project that might help you.

https://github.com/jgilfelt/SystemBarTint

enter image description here

3
  • Thanks for the response, i've also found this project, it's really close that i want to achieve, but instead the gradient effect i need a flat one.
    – takakeiji
    Jun 23, 2014 at 3:05
  • Ok, so try to set using the color pattern as I told before. Not sure if this will work. Jun 23, 2014 at 3:07
  • I've just tried your option, and didn't work as i need, anyway i found other solution similar for your recommended project, is not exactly what i want but the result is more polished (Badly what i want seems that is an TouchWiz only feature): link, it's from a Google employee blog and it's a very interesting approach. And thanks for your time.
    – takakeiji
    Jun 23, 2014 at 16:55
0

I am pretty sure that the samsung dialer app gets root permissions because it's a system app. To set a flat background, you would either need root permission or somehow simulate a samsung app to gain access. I think the gradient is your best option.

You could also set your app to full screen and simulate fake system bars that change based on the device so that they look the same as the normal ones, but that would take a lot of time to make.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.